French Fry Sauce

French fry sauce: a versatile, tangy condiment perfect for dipping fries, enhancing burgers, or jazzing up sandwiches. Homemade and delicious!

Ingredients

  • 1 cup mayonnaise
  • ¼ cup ketchup
  • 2 tablespoons pickle relish sweet or dill, depending on your preference
  • ½ teaspoon onion powder
  • ½ teaspoon garlic powder
  • Salt and pepper to taste

Instructions

  • Combine the mayonnaise, ketchup, relish, onion powder, and garlic powder in a bowl. Mix until all the ingredients are well incorporated.
  • Taste the sauce and add salt and pepper as needed.
  • For the best flavor, cover the bowl and refrigerate the sauce for at least an hour before serving. This allows the flavors to blend together.
  • Serve the sauce with French fries or any other dish that could use a tangy, creamy condiment. Enjoy!
